The Centre for Cell Therapy and Regenerative Medicine of the Tri-Service General Hospital was launched on 20 October. Dr Yi-Jen Hung, Superintendent of the hospital, said that in the future it will support the development of national policies, become a regenerative medicine incubator, create a platform for sharing regenerative medicine resources and promote the development of Taiwan's regenerative medicine industry.
Hung pointed out that in May 2019, the hospital became a medical centre capable of performing cellular therapy, and in July 2020, it formed an alliance with Young Cell. After going through all kinds of severe challenges during the epidemic, the Center for Cell Therapy and Renegenerative Medicine has become operational since September this year.
According to Hung, the center, jointly established by Young Cell, is the first in Taiwan of its kind, representing a milestone in Taiwan's regenerative medicine field by leveraging on the strengths of hospital and the biotech sector.
Tri-Service General Hospital is the first in Taiwan approved officially to conduct cellular therapy, and that the Center for Cellular Therapy and Regenerative Medicine will bring together various cellular therapy providers, and a team of physicians, to provide novel therapeutics and high-quality medical facility.
The Cell Therapy and Regenerative Medicine Centre mainly focuses on cell therapy that has been officially approved, including: autologous immune cell therapy, autologous adipose stem cell therapy and autologous chondrocyte therapy, which are suitable for the treatment of various types of cancers that have failed to respond to the standard treatment in the stages of 1 to 4, such as liver, lung, breast, ovarian, colorectal, head and neck cancers, blood cancers, lymphoma, etc., as well as the cellular repair therapy such as knee and joint cartilage defects, massive burns and subcutaneous tissue defects. The centre is now located in the Tri-Service General Hospital Tingzhou Branch and occupies an area of 440 ping. The treatment rooms are en-suite, with independent and hygienic aseptic operation methods for cell collection, preparation and transfer, providing a more comfortable experience than in a medical centre, and offering patients a high standard of medical services.
